How do you download and install the client safely? 📥
To begin your path toward competitive excellence, you must first secure a clean installation of your chosen esport client. Always navigate directly to the official developer website or verified digital storefronts like Steam, Epic Games, or official console marketplaces.
Avoid downloading launchers or configuration files from third-party forums or unverified file-sharing platforms. These external sources often bundle malicious software or outdated game builds that can compromise your personal data and lead to account bans.
Advertisement
Once the installer is ready, choose a directory on your fastest solid-state drive to ensure rapid loading times. Follow the on-screen instructions, allowing the installer to verify file integrity and download any required anti-cheat software.
After installation, set up your account using a strong, unique password and immediately enable multi-factor authentication. Safeguarding your competitive identity prevents unauthorized access and keeps your hard-earned progress secure from potential digital threats.

What system configurations ensure peak performance? 🖥️
A poorly configured system can actively hinder your reaction times and cost you critical matches during intense competitive encounters.
- Compare your hardware specs against the recommended requirements, aiming for components that exceed standard targets.
- Adjust your operating system power settings to high performance, ensuring your CPU operates at maximum frequency.
- Optimize your graphics control panel by prioritizing performance over visual quality to boost overall frame rates.
- Enable low-latency modes in your GPU settings to minimize the delay between physical input and on-screen action.
- Update your graphics and chipset drivers regularly to prevent sudden software crashes and performance degradation.
- Clear temporary files and maintain at least twenty percent free space on your primary SSD for optimal operation.
Taking the time to prepare your system creates a stable foundation, allowing you to focus entirely on strategy.
How can you guarantee smooth and stable gameplay? 🌐
A stable internet connection remains the absolute backbone of online gaming, making a wired ethernet connection vastly superior to wireless alternatives. Physical cables prevent packet loss and sudden latency spikes during crucial match moments.
Configure your in-game graphics settings to match your monitor refresh rate, disabling resource-heavy options like motion blur and chromatic aberration. These cinematic effects only serve to obscure your vision and drop your frames.
Invest in a high-quality stereo headset and configure the audio settings to emphasize directional cues and footsteps. Sound design in modern esports provides vital spatial awareness, often revealing enemy positions before you see them.
Close all non-essential background applications, web browsers, and automatic update clients before launching your game. This simple habit frees up system memory and keeps network bandwidth dedicated solely to your active match.
Which core competencies should competitive players develop? 🧠
Refining your mechanical reflexes is vital, yet top-tier competitors spend equal effort developing spatial awareness and muscle memory. Regular practice drills in custom lobbies can help you memorize recoil patterns and map angles.
Clear, concise communication forms the cornerstone of effective teamwork, especially when coordinating complex defensive strategies. Avoid clogging voice channels with unnecessary chatter, focusing instead on calling out enemy positions and active cool-downs.
Careful resource management determines the outcome of prolonged matches, requiring you to track utility item usage. Knowing when to save your abilities for the next round is often better than panicking.
Adaptability allows you to counter opposing strategies on the fly when your initial game plan begins to fail. Studying alternative tactics ensures you remain resilient and unpredictable throughout the entire tournament bracket.
